What is CVE-2026-4883?

The Piotnet Forms plugin for WordPress is susceptible to an arbitrary file upload vulnerability due to inadequate file type validation in the 'piotnetforms_ajax_form_builder' function. The plugin's extension blacklist is insufficient, as it only blocks certain extensions (php, phpt, php5, php7, exe) but permits the upload of potentially harmful file types like .phar and .phtml. This flaw enables unauthenticated attackers to leverage file fields within forms to upload arbitrary files on the server, raising concerns for potential remote code execution.

Affected Version(s)

Piotnet Forms 0 <= 2.1.40
